SEOUL, President Yoon Suk Yeol on Tuesday received the diplomatic credentials of 15 newly appointed ambassadors from abroad. They include two ambassadors from Thailand and Japan, as well as 13 nonresident ambassadors from the Democratic Republic of the Congo, Eswatini, Iceland, Suriname, Mauritius, Samoa, Trinidad and Tobago, Equatorial Guinea, Burundi, Bosnia and Herzegovina, Mauritania, and Niger. Nonresident ambassadors are diplomats stationed in a third country while being accredited to South Korea. Source: Yonhap News Agency
